Graham announced in February that he would take part in the Arctic Challenge, which would involve traveling 1,000 kilometers non-stop across the Arctic Ocean.

“The impact of The Arctic Challenge goes far beyond the four athletes and the Arctic Ocean,” Graham wrote on X at the time.

“With a mission to inspire young minds, the team aims to challenge the next generation to overcome their limiting beliefs and forge their own path.”

Starting in Tromso, Norway, and ending in Longyearbyen, Norway, the trip is expected to last 10 to 21 days.

Graham will be joined by former US Navy Seal Andrew Tropp, 2021 USRowing Coastal Female Athlete of the Year Hannah Huppi and 2021 rowing bronze medalist John Huppi.

Graham shared on Cameron Jordan’s podcast in January that he was looking forward to getting away from football and trying this new experience.

Pat McAfee’s Playing Days

PAT McAfee had a hugely successful career before embarking on a career in media.

The talk show star played the role of punter in the NFL for eight seasons, from 2009 to 2016.

He was selected in the seventh round of the 2009 NFL Draft out of West Virginia and spent his entire career with the Indianapolis Colts.

The former punter was named to the Pro Bowl in 2014 and 2016, and he was also a first-team All-Pro in 2014.
